Why Physiotherapy Matters as We Age?
Ageing brings natural changes to muscles, joints, and balance. Without proper care, these changes can limit mobility and increase the risk of injury. Physiotherapy addresses these concerns by focusing on how the body moves as a whole, rather than treating symptoms in isolation.
Physiotherapy helps ageing adults:
Improve joint mobility and flexibility
Maintain muscle strength and endurance
Enhance balance and coordination
Reduce the risk of falls and injuries
Manage chronic conditions more effectively
By keeping the body moving correctly, physiotherapy supports independence and confidence in everyday activities.

Managing Pain and Chronic Conditions Naturally
Many ageing adults live with chronic conditions such as arthritis, joint stiffness, or recurring muscle pain. Physiotherapy offers a drug-free way to manage these issues through education, guided exercises, and manual techniques.
Common conditions physiotherapy helps manage include:
Osteoarthritis and joint degeneration
Lower back and neck pain
Shoulder and hip stiffness
Tendon and ligament overuse injuries
With consistent care, physiotherapy can reduce discomfort, improve joint health, and enhance overall quality of life.

Improving Balance and Preventing Falls
Balance naturally declines with age, increasing the risk of falls. Physiotherapy plays a key role in improving stability and coordination through specific balance and strength exercises.
Balance-focused physiotherapy can help:
Strengthen stabilising muscles
Improve reaction time
Enhance confidence while walking or changing direction
Reduce fear of falling
Fall prevention is not only about safety—it’s about preserving independence and peace of mind.
